Students should understand that the tuition fees charged for their degree programs is not the only expense that is involved in the cost of attending the university. There are several other expenses that are involved in the cost of attending the university, which primarily includes housing, dining, textbooks, supplies, and the cost of living. What's more, at Northwestern Health Sciences University, the total tuition and fees for the enrolled students come out to be around $12,780 in a year. Apart from that, they should also pay an average amount of $1,000 toward books and supplies, $10,830 for room and boarding charges, and $9,998 toward other expenses in a year. Hence, based on this information, the overall cost of attending the university adds up to around $34,608 per year.
